Kevin Kyle enjoys his trial with Russian team

KEVIN Kyle said he "enjoyed" his trial match with Russian club Spartak Nalchik yesterday and had an open mind about where his future lay.

The Kilmarnock striker, who is out of contract in the summer, flew out to Turkey for Spartak's pre-season training camp to play in a game against Zhemchuzhina Sochi. The 28-year-old did not score but had a hand in one of the goals in a 3-0 win.

"I've not decided on anything; I've just come out to speak to them," Kyle told BBC Scotland. "I enjoyed the experience."

Spartak's assistant coach Kazbek Nakhushev this week revealed his side are interested in signing Kyle.

Nakhushev is quoted as saying: "We will have an impression of Kyle right after the game and will say then where we stand. We are aiming to recruit several new players. We recently had a look at a Slovenian player – but I can tell you, he didn't impress. So Kyle has a good chance of being offered a deal."

Kyle is expected to play for Kilmanrock in tomorrow's SPL clash at Hibernian. But he will be able to join Spartak at any time before the Russian Premier Liga season starts the following weekend as they do not operate under the standard transfer window.
